Artwork Description

This artwork is created on wood panel - 2cm thick - it can be hung as it is but a frame would accentuate the artwork.
.
It would suit a natural oak, white or black frame. An oak frame would harmonize the gold and neutral colours, whilst the black would accent the dark line work on the mountain slope and create a strong finish. A white frame will create a crisp, light edge and pick up any white mouldings/trim or furniture.
It will depend on your home/office and what will suit the environment. You are welcome to message me for advice.

.
A golden haze settles on a mountain range.
This highly textured artwork includes shades of of olive, grey blue, light green, grey and black. There is a pearlescent light magenta that will show in certain angles and lighting.
The gold WILL change in the light - creating movement.
.
The paint is applied thickly and the texture is apparent over the whole artwork- the metallic gold is several different shades.

Artist Bio

Australian artist Laurie Franklin (b. 1981) is an established, internationally collected painter known for her layering of paint and mixed media to create tactile works ranging from mountains, seascapes to florals and abstracted forms.

Laurie has sold 1000s of artworks since starting painting in 2002, artwork is displayed in hotels, restaurants and held collections in over 20 countries. Past hotel projects have included 200m of hand painted wallpaper and hundreds of original artworks for hotel suites.

Based in Melbourne, Australia she works from a large studio space allowing several artworks to be worked on simultaneously. She travels and undertakes Art residencies around the world, the changing scenery influences her unique approach to capturing the intrinsic character of the landscape . Her gestural style, tight color palette and use of metallic elements create tactile, intriguing artworks.
